Struct esp32c3::i2s::rx_clkm_conf::W
source · pub struct W(_);
Expand description
Register RX_CLKM_CONF
writer
Implementations§
source§impl W
impl W
sourcepub fn rx_clkm_div_num(&mut self) -> RX_CLKM_DIV_NUM_W<'_, 0>
pub fn rx_clkm_div_num(&mut self) -> RX_CLKM_DIV_NUM_W<'_, 0>
Bits 0:7 - Integral I2S clock divider value
sourcepub fn rx_clk_active(&mut self) -> RX_CLK_ACTIVE_W<'_, 26>
pub fn rx_clk_active(&mut self) -> RX_CLK_ACTIVE_W<'_, 26>
Bit 26 - I2S Rx module clock enable signal.
sourcepub fn rx_clk_sel(&mut self) -> RX_CLK_SEL_W<'_, 27>
pub fn rx_clk_sel(&mut self) -> RX_CLK_SEL_W<'_, 27>
Bits 27:28 - Select I2S Rx module source clock. 0: no clock. 1: APLL. 2: CLK160. 3: I2S_MCLK_in.
sourcepub fn mclk_sel(&mut self) -> MCLK_SEL_W<'_, 29>
pub fn mclk_sel(&mut self) -> MCLK_SEL_W<'_, 29>
Bit 29 - 0: UseI2S Tx module clock as I2S_MCLK_OUT. 1: UseI2S Rx module clock as I2S_MCLK_OUT.